The National Lottery releases draws on specific days. Wednesday nights and Saturday nights are standard, though dates shift occasionally. Results go live around 10.45 PM on draw nights, sometimes a few minutes either side depending on the broadcast schedule.
Your first option is checking directly on the official National Lottery platform. They publish numbers as soon as the draw finishes. It's the most straightforward approach-log in, search your ticket, and you'll see instantly if anything matched. No waiting for emails or confirmations.
Phone notifications work if you want it pushed to you. You can set alerts so you don't have to remember to check. The moment results post, you'll get notified. Some people prefer this because they're not refreshing every two minutes.
Local retailers and newsagents often have printed results up the same night, though obviously this takes longer than checking online. If you prefer handling a physical copy, this is viable but slower than digital.Third-party lottery checkers exist across the web and apps. They pull results from official sources and display them in different formats. Some people find them easier to navigate than the primary channels. They're legitimate-they're just repurposing the same official data with a different interface.
Television results come later in the evening, so if speed matters, don't rely on waiting for broadcast. The draw happens, results post online, then TV coverage follows hours later.
Subscription services sometimes offer faster notifications than standard channels. If you play regularly, these can be worth setting up. You get results pushed before general public visibility in some cases.
Check your ticket carefully when you get results. Matching all six numbers is rare-most people win smaller amounts matching fewer digits. Review the prize structure so you know what you actually won, not just whether something hit.Results stay accessible for a long time, so you're not locked into checking immediately. If you miss the draw night, the numbers remain available for weeks afterward. However, there are claim deadlines-usually around 180 days from the draw date-so don't ignore winning tickets for months.
